For the most part, all contractors, subcontractors, laborers, materials suppliers, and equipment suppliers who provide labor or materials to a property in Texas are not required to have a written contract (a verbal agreement is sufficient) to qualify for the right to file a lien.
Deposit the Lien Amount with the Court: A lien can be removed from the property if you file a lawsuit and deposit the lien amount into the courts registry. This allows the parties to litigate the validity of the claim, without the lien encumbering the property.
Georgia lien law requires a lien action to be filed within 365 days from the date the lien is filed for record, and not a day later. See O.C.G.A. 44-14-361.1(a)(3).
The unpaid lien will stay on your credit report for 10 years after it is filed. After paying it off, it may stay on your credit history for up to seven years.
Georgia Liens are Valid for One Year: In Georgia, a Claim of Lien is valid for one year from the date that the lien is filed. If the lien claimant files a materialmens lien and then doesnt enforce its lien rights within the year, then the mechanics or materialmens lien will automatically expire.
